body { background: #a3dbfe; margin: 0px; padding: 0px; background-position: middle; font-family: Verdana; font-size: 12px; color: #ffffff;  }
div#main { width: 728px; margin: auto; position: relative; }
div.logo { float: left; }
div.splash { background: url(../images/splash.png) no-repeat; width: 157px; height: 130px; }
div.before_splash { float: right; padding-top: 15px; padding-right: 41px; }
div.menu_bg { background: url(../images/menu_bg.png) no-repeat; width: 728px; height: 35px; clear: both; }
div.content_bg { background: url(../images/content_bg.jpg) no-repeat; width: 791px; height: 480px; }
div.menu { font-family: Verdana; font-size: 10px; color: #ffffff; font-weight: bold; padding-left: 27px; padding-top: 12px; }
div.menu a { font-family: Verdana; font-size: 10px; color: #ffffff; font-weight: bold; text-decoration: none; }
div.menu a.selected { color: #77cdf1; }
div.menu a:hover { color: #77cdf1; }

div.bullet { float: left; padding-top: 4px; padding-right: 3px; padding-left: 20px; }
div.after_bullet { float: left; width: 350px; }

div#home_dd { position: absolute; display: none; }
div#babies_dd { position: absolute; display: none; margin-left: 10px; }
div#toddlers_dd { position: absolute; display: none; margin-left: 53px; }
div#juniors_dd { position: absolute; display: none; margin-left: 110px; }

div.ddc { background: #2e57a6; width: 117px; line-height: 19px; height: auto; padding-left: 10px; padding-top: 10px; }
div.ddb { background: url(../images/ddb.png) no-repeat; width: 127px; height: 13px; }

div.ct { background: url(../images/ct.png) no-repeat; width: 728px; height: 11px; margin-top: 10px; }
div.cc { background: #2e57a5 url(../images/cb.png) no-repeat;; width: 688px; height: auto; padding: 20px; padding-top: 10px; background-position: bottom; }
div.cb { background: url(../images/cb.png) no-repeat; width: 728px; height: 12px; }

div.left_img { float: left; margin-top: -21px; margin-left: -21px; margin-bottom: -20px; }

table.td_table td { border: dotted 1px #FFFFFF; }